2. Bust circumference anti-yellowing agent: definition and classification
(I) What is a bust anti-yellowing agent?
Bust cotton anti-yellowing agent is a functional additive specially used to improve the anti-yellowing properties of underwear fabrics. Simply put, it is a chemical additive that can effectively inhibit or delay the color changes caused by fabrics due to oxidation, ultraviolet rays or other external factors. This technique is widely used in the manufacturing process of underwear, especially in areas such as the bust area that are susceptible to sweat erosion.
Depending on the mechanism of action, bust anti-yellowing agents can be divided into the following categories:
Category | Features | Applicable scenarios |
---|---|---|
Anti-oxidation-anti-yellowing agent | The oxidation reaction is mainly prevented by capturing free radicals, thereby preventing the fabric from turning yellow. | Commonly used in the production of underwear made of easily oxidized materials such as cotton and polyester. |
Ultraviolet absorption anti-yellowing agent | Contains ultraviolet shielding components, which can reduce the damage caused to the fabric by direct sunlight and extend its service life. | Sports lingerie suitable for wearing when you are in outdoor activities. |
Enzyme-inhibiting anti-yellowing agent | Inhibit the effect of enzymes in human sweat and avoid the chemical reaction between sweat stains and fabric fibers leading to yellowing. | Especially suitable for fitted clothing used in high temperature environments in summer. |
Comprehensive Anti-yellowing Agent | Combining multiple functions in one, it can not only prevent oxidation but also resist ultraviolet rays, but also resist sweat contamination and provide all-round protection. | The preferred solution for high-end brand underwear. |

3. Working principle of bust anti-yellowing agent
The reason why bust anti-yellowing agents can effectively fight yellowing is mainly due to their unique molecular structure and complex chemical reaction processes. The following are the specific working principles of several common types of anti-yellowing agents:
(I) Anti-oxidation type anti-yellowing agent
The core of this type of anti-yellowing agent is to capture free radicals and interrupt the oxidation chain reaction. We know that when oxygen in the air comes into contact with the surface of the fabric, it triggers a series of complex chemical reactions, typically the production of free radicals. These free radicals are extremely active, and they attack the fiber molecular chains, causing them to break and release yellow by-products.
Step | Description |
---|---|
Free radical generation | After oxygen comes into contact with the fabric surface, free radicals are formed under the action of light or thermal energy. |
Free radical capture | The functional groups (such as hydroxyl and carboxyl) in the anti-yellowing agent actively bind to the free radical to form a stable compound and terminate the reaction chain. |
Reduced yellow byproducts | As the oxidation reaction is inhibited, the yellow deposition on the fabric surface is significantly reduced, thus maintaining the original white gloss. |
For example, benzotriazole compounds are a common anti-oxidation anti-yellowing agent. The molecules contain multiple hydroxyl functional groups and can efficiently capture free radicals. Therefore, they are widely used in various textiles.
(II) UV absorption anti-yellowing agent
UV rays are one of the main causes of fading and aging of fabrics. Underwear that is exposed to the sun for a long time often loses its original bright colors due to the strong radiation of ultraviolet rays. UV-absorbing anti-yellowing agents were born to deal with this problem.
Step | Description |
---|---|
Ultraviolet capture | Specific molecules in anti-yellowing agents (such as benzophenone, cyanocoumarin) can absorb ultraviolet energy and convert them into harmless heat energy and release them. |
Energy Transfer | Through the intermolecular energy transfer mechanism, the absorbed energy is quickly dispersed to avoid further damage to the fabric. |
Color stability improvement | Under the action of ultraviolet protection, the color of the fabric can be maintained for a long time and is not prone to yellowing or fading. |
Taking benzophenone as an example, it is an efficient and stable UV absorber, commonly used in outdoor sportswear and sunscreen underwear, providing double protection for the wearer.
(III) Enzyme-inhibiting anti-yellowing agent
Sweat contains a large amount of proteolytic enzymes, which will undergo hydrolysis reaction after contacting the fabric, forming small molecule substances with yellow dye properties, resulting in yellowing of the fabric. The mission of enzyme-inhibiting anti-yellowing agents is to block this process.
Step | Description |
---|---|
Inhibition of enzyme activity | Active ingredients in anti-yellowing agent(such as metal ion chelating agents) bind to enzymes in sweat, reducing their catalytic efficiency. |
Reaction rate slows down | The effect of enzymes is further weakened by changing local pH or increasing competitive substrate concentration. |
Reduced risk of yellowing | End, there are almost no obvious yellow marks on the surface of the fabric, and they remain fresh and clean. |
For example, EDTA (ethylenediamine IV) is a commonly used metal ion chelating agent. It can indirectly inhibit the activity of enzymes in sweat by binding to calcium and magnesium ions, thereby achieving the purpose of anti-yellowing.
